Solo Seat Experiance and some mods

Agree that the Solo seat is a vast improvement to the stock [in my case, Scrambler] plank.
To overcome the vibration & lack of rack strength, I have had two flat bars welded to the subframe & fitted 4 long screws that bolt through the bars into the upright bars of the rack.
For longer journeys I have hard a larger rack made.
For pillion passenger using the small rack I have had a small velcro pad made.
